An experimental base was created using a racing motorbike driven by piston combustion engine, which is equipped with a developed inlet pipe. The inlet air pressure value changed from the atmospheric level to the under-pressure level. This change is connected directly with increasing of the power output and torque. The tuned racing outlet system was applied for measuring of the outlet pipe characteristics. There were investigated influences of the individual configurations in the case of both analysed systems by means of the sequential experimental measurements. During measurement performed using the final configuration of the inlet system there was recorded an increment of the power output on high speed what is illustrated at comparison of global benefit relating to the basic version. The presented inlet pipe was successful in the motorsport area and it was patented, as well.
